Lugo, on the brink of relegation, faces a Málaga that remains convinced salvation is possible

Like Ibiza, Lugo has been teetering near the drop zone, and this Sunday will welcome a Málaga side that has recovered strongly in recent weeks. So much so that fans and players have united behind a shared objective: staying in the league, a goal that seemed almost unattainable just days earlier.

The Andalusians defeated Cartagena 1-0 at La Rosaleda and, with 36 points, sit just five points from the safety threshold. On paper, Lugo also has a viable chance to close the gap further when playing at home.

The Galicians arrive at this matchday perched at the bottom of the table. Their previous outing ended in a 2-1 defeat at Oviedo, leaving them with 27 points and standing close to the dreaded First RFEF relegation zone.
